Maxheap stl
Web4 aug. 2024 · is_heap. is_heap in its simplest form takes two parameters and returns a boolean. If the input range is a max heap, it returns true, otherwise false. The two input … minHeap = new PriorityQueue<>(); Max Heap: PriorityQueue
Maxheap stl
Did you know?
Web20 mrt. 2016 · In C++ STL, there is priority_queue that can directly be used to implement Max Heap. In order to fully understand the code, make sure you are familiar with …</integer> </integer>
Web22 nov. 2024 · Given a list of integers nums, return whether it represents a max heap. That is, for every i we have that: nums[i] ≥ nums[2*i + 1] if 2*i + 1 is within bounds nums[i] ≥ nums[2*i + 2] if 2*i + 2 is within bounds Example 1 Input nums = [4, 2, 3, 0, 1] Output true . Max Heap Check Algorithm. Intuitively we go through the array once and check if the …Web15 mei 2024 · STL의 make_heap comp를 정의하지 않으면 default한 연산자는 operator< 비교 함수를 사용하고 Max Heap을 구성하게 된다. 부모, 자식의 두 인자를 각각 첫번째, 두번째 인자로 두고 comp (operator<)함수에 대입하면 모두 false값을 갖는다는 것을 확인할 수 있다.
Web14 nov. 2024 · Heap is a tree-based which is used for fast retrieval of largest (max heap) or smallest (min heap) element. This DS is used in the priority queue, prims algo, heap sort … Web15 jun. 2024 · STL 을 사용할 수 있는 상황이라면 꼭 STL 을 사용하도록 합시다. 나보다 똑똑한 사람들이 나보다 더 많은 시간을 들여서 작성하고 최적화한 코드입니다. 구현된 STL-like 자료 구조들은 Github Repo 에서도 확인 하실 수 있습니다. 혹시나 있을 버그는 댓글 혹은 이메일로 제보해 주시면 수정하도록 하겠습니다. 들어가기에 앞서 Documents 잡담 구현 Documents …
Web18 apr. 2024 · 모두의 코드를 참고하여 핵심 내용을 간추리고 있습니다. 자세한 내용은 모두의 코드의 씹어먹는 C++ 강좌를 참고해 주세요! STL algorithm STL algorithm 라이브러리는 STL 자료구조를 다루는 데 필요한 편리한 메소드들을 제공하고 있다. STL 알고리즘 라이브러리에 있는 함수들은 대체로 다음과 같은 두 가지 ...
WebWe have introduced the heap data structure in the above post and discussed heapify-up, push, heapify-down, and pop operations. In this post, the implementation of the max-heap and min-heap data structure is provided. Their implementation is somewhat similar to std::priority_queue. Max Heap implementation in C++: Download Run Code Output: … is the ledge on netflixWeb19 mrt. 2024 · code remove min from heap in c++ c++ max heap stl heap in c++; heapify function c++ Defination of the heap in c++ how define max heap in cpp min heap and max heap] min heap comperator c++ what are max heap c ++ use heap create a max heap in c++ make max heap in C++ using stl max heap c c++ by default provides min heap?? … is the lectric xp lite good for hillsWeb23 jan. 2024 · how to make a heap using stl in c++; double max value c++; heap in cpp stl; max heap c++; min heap in c++; c++ min; max pooling in c++; max in c++; min heap …i have feet but no legs which animal am iWeb[C++] STL, implemented from scratch. 0. kashish25798 2. June 26, 2024 6:09 AM. 83 VIEWS. We'll be maintaining a max heap of k elements. Whenever a new element comes, we remove the largest ( top of heap as it's a maxHeap ) Insert the new element and percolateUp; At max we'll end up creating a maxHeap of size (k+1). i have fatty liver what can i eatWeb23 jun. 2024 · The standard deletion operation on Heap is to delete the element present at the root node of the Heap. That is if it is a Max Heap, the standard deletion operation will delete the maximum element and if it is a Min heap, it will delete the minimum element. Process of Deletion: i have felt that suffering isWeb3 jun. 2024 · heap이란 heap은 최대값과 최소값을 빠르게 찾기 위해 만들어진 완전이진트리로 구성된 자료구조이다. - maxheap 최대힙 maxheap에서는 임의의 한 트리가 있을 때에 root 노드는 항상 최대값을 갖는다. - minheap 최소힙 minheap에서는 임의의 한 트리가 있을 때에 root 노드는 항상 최소값을 갖는다. 둘의 공통점 ...i have fast internet but steam downloads slowWeb5 feb. 2024 · STL priority_queue is the implementation of the Heap Data structure. By default, it’s a max heap and we can easily use it for primitive datatypes. To learn more about C++ STL, visit the C++ guided path. This blog covers the concept of the priority queue, its syntax, methods, time complexity, and space complexity, and their examples. i have feelings for two people